The book offers a pioneering approach that merges Worst-Case Execution Time (WCET) analysis with code generation, enhancing the efficiency of compiler design. It introduces innovative optimization techniques derived from the collaboration between compilers and timing analyzers, aiming to improve performance and reliability in software development. This comprehensive integration addresses the critical need for timing considerations in code generation, making it a valuable resource for developers and researchers in the field of computer science and software engineering.
